Cellular Phone Usage
Cellular phone usage may cause interference with the vehicle's radio.
This interference may occur when making or receiving phone calls, charging the phone's battery, or simply having the phone on. This interference can cause an increased level of static while listening to the radio. If static is received while listening to the radio, unplug the cellular phone and turn it off.
